Step 3: Fields Mapping
Here you'll be able to map your Prospect.io information with your InTouch Follow-up fields.
- You will have InTouch Follow-up fields on the left. Match the information you wish to pass align from Prospect.io
 - Based on InTouch Follow-up functionality, some fields might be required; if this is the case, you can identify those fields with a * (star), so be sure to map all them
 - You can also use the functions to customize information like reformatting dates and times or modifying text, phone numbers and so on.
 - You may leave blank the box of a field's information you don't want to send through. Clicking on the Show unmapped fields button you will have visibility on all the available fields still not mapped
 

Step 3.A: Leads Filter (Optional)
If you'd like you could add a filter for incoming leads. This filter will sync only leads that meet the configured conditions
- Click on the link Add Filter for Incoming Leads on the top left
 - A popup wil be opened where you can configure the filter
 - You can define a series of condition to filter the leads. The lead will be synced only when all the conditions will be met
 - Once finished, click the Save Changes button to switch back to the Fields Mapping to continue with the bridge configuration
